The Ayurvedic Perspective on Detoxification

According to Ayurveda, detoxification plays a crucial role in preventive healthcare. Ayurvedic detox focuses on balancing the body’s three doshas — Vata, Pitta, and Kapha — while optimizing Agni, the digestive fire. As Agni weakens, undigested food and emotions create Ama, causing blockages in bodily channels (Srotas) and contributing to chronic diseases, fatigue, and emotional disorders.

Understanding Panchakarma: The Fivefold Detoxification

Panchakarma is one of the most comprehensive detoxification treatments offered by Ayurveda. The Sanskrit term panchakarma translates to “five actions” or “five treatments.”. Through this cleansing process, the body is expelled of accumulated toxins (ama), its innate healing ability is restored, and the body, mind, and spirit are restored.It is based on the principle that everything in the universe, including the human body, is composed of five fundamental elements—ether, air, fire, water, and earth. Panchakarma works by restoring equilibrium among the three doshas—Vata, Pitta, and Kapha—tailoring therapies to an individual’s constitution (Prakriti).

Ayurvedic practitioners administer therapies such as Abhyangam (herbal oil massage), Shirodhara (medicated oil streaming onto the forehead), Udvarthanam (herbal powder massage), Basti (medicated enemas to cleanse toxins from the colon), and Nasya (nasal therapy to clear toxins from the head and respiratory system). These therapies, combined with a sattvic diet, yoga, herbal formulations, and lifestyle modifications, lead to profound purification, revitalization and promoting mental clarity.

Ayurveda’s Role in Emotional Detoxification

An integral part of holistic detoxification is emotional cleansing as well as physical cleansing. Unresolved emotions can cause energetic blockages, which can negatively affect health. As part of Ayurvedic philosophy, the mind-body connection is emphasized, emphasizing the role of Sattva (purity) in achieving emotional and mental equilibrium.

The practice of Abhyanga (self-massage with herbal oils) helps release stored emotional toxins by stimulating Marma points, which are similar to acupuncture points in Traditional Chinese Medicine. A blend of adaptogenic herbs, including Brahmi, Ashwagandha, and Shatavari, supports a healthy nervous system, reduces stress, and improves emotional resilience. Furthermore, nutrient-dense, organic, and fresh meals are encouraged by Ayurvedic dietary guidelines to improve mood and mental clarity.

The Synergy of Yoga and Ayurveda in Detoxification

With similar Vedic origins, yoga and ayurveda compliment each other to promote comprehensive cleansing. Yoga promotes detoxification through movement, breathwork, and meditation, whereas Ayurveda concentrates on interior purification. Yoga Nidra, meditation, and mantra chanting calm the nervous system, promoting emotional detoxification, spiritual alignment, and mental clarity. Pranayama (breath control) cleanses the respiratory system and balances energy. Asanas (postures) aid in digestion and aid in the removal of toxins.
